Jermaine Baker shooting: Armed officer could face charges | Jermaine Baker shooting: Armed officer could face charges |
(about 2 hours later) | |
A Met Police firearms officer could face prosecution over the shooting of a man who was killed during a botched attempt to free a prisoner. | A Met Police firearms officer could face prosecution over the shooting of a man who was killed during a botched attempt to free a prisoner. |
Jermaine Baker, 28, from Tottenham, was killed by armed officers last December. | Jermaine Baker, 28, from Tottenham, was killed by armed officers last December. |
The Independent Police Complaints Commission (IPCC) said there was "an indication a criminal offence may have been committed". | The Independent Police Complaints Commission (IPCC) said there was "an indication a criminal offence may have been committed". |
It is to refer the case to the Crown Prosecution Service to consider whether charges should be brought. | It is to refer the case to the Crown Prosecution Service to consider whether charges should be brought. |
Mr Baker and two other men were waiting in a car to try to free a prisoner who was being taken to Wood Green Crown Court. | Mr Baker and two other men were waiting in a car to try to free a prisoner who was being taken to Wood Green Crown Court. |

IPCC commissioner Cindy Butts said it had gathered evidence relating to the actions of the firearms officer who shot Mr Baker. | IPCC commissioner Cindy Butts said it had gathered evidence relating to the actions of the firearms officer who shot Mr Baker. |
Last month the senior police officer involved in the operation was allowed to retire, despite being under investigation. | Last month the senior police officer involved in the operation was allowed to retire, despite being under investigation. |
A legal bid by Mr Baker's family to stop the policeman- known as "officer FE16" - retiring failed after a High Court judge ruled he was free to leave the force. | A legal bid by Mr Baker's family to stop the policeman- known as "officer FE16" - retiring failed after a High Court judge ruled he was free to leave the force. |
Mr Baker's mother Margaret Smith has vowed to continue her "fight for justice". | |
In a statement issued by their solicitor, Mr Baker's family said: "We have very serious concerns about the circumstances in which Jermaine was shot. | |
"Our priority is to find out the truth and have anyone responsible for his death held to account. | |
"We look to the CPS to ensure that justice is done." |
